rangiora /ˌræŋɡɪˈɔːrə; ˌræŋɪ-/ n ( pl -ra)
  1. an evergreen shrub or small tree, Brachyglottis repanda, of New Zealand, having large ovate leaves and small greenish-white flowers: family Asteraceae (composites)
Etymology: Māori
